# Collect support logs in Microsoft Defender ATP using live response
**Applies to:**
- [Microsoft Defender Advanced Threat Protection (Microsoft Defender ATP)](https://go.microsoft.com/fwlink/p/?linkid=2069559)
When contacting support, you may be asked to provide the output package of the Microsoft Defender ATP Client Analyzer tool.
This topic provides instructions on how to run the tool via Live Response.
1. Download the appropriate script
* Microsoft Defender ATP client sensor logs only: [LiveAnalyzer.ps1 script](https://aka.ms/MDATPLiveAnalyzer).
- Result package approximate size: ~100Kb
* Microsoft Defender ATP client sensor and Antivirus logs: [LiveAnalyzer+MDAV.ps1 script](https://aka.ms/MDATPLiveAnalyzerAV).
- Result package approximate size: ~10Mb
2. Initiate a [Live Response session](live-response.md#initiate-a-live-response-session-on-a-device) on the machine you need to investigate.
3. Select **Upload file to library**.
![Image of upload file](images/upload-file.png)
4. Select **Choose file**.
![Image of choose file button](images/choose-file.png)
5. Select the downloaded file named MDATPLiveAnalyzer.ps1 and then click on **Confirm**
![Image of choose file button](images/analyzer-file.png)
6. While still in the LiveResponse session, use the commands below to run the analyzer and collect the result file:
```console
Run MDATPLiveAnalyzer.ps1
GetFile "C:\ProgramData\Microsoft\Windows Defender Advanced Threat Protection\Downloads\MDATPClientAnalyzerResult.zip" -auto
```
![Image of commands](images/analyzer-commands.png)
>[!NOTE]
> - The latest preview version of MDATPClientAnalyzer can be downloaded here: [https://aka.ms/Betamdatpanalyzer](https://aka.ms/Betamdatpanalyzer).
>
> - The LiveAnalyzer script downloads the troubleshooting package on the destination machine from: https://mdatpclientanalyzer.blob.core.windows.net.
>
> If you cannot allow the machine to reach the above URL, then upload MDATPClientAnalyzerPreview.zip file to the library before running the LiveAnalyzer script:
>
> ```console
> PutFile MDATPClientAnalyzerPreview.zip -overwrite
> Run MDATPLiveAnalyzer.ps1
> GetFile "C:\ProgramData\Microsoft\Windows Defender Advanced Threat Protection\Downloads\MDATPClientAnalyzerResult.zip" -auto
> ```
>
> - For more information on gathering data locally on a machine in case the machine isn't communicating with Microsoft Defender ATP cloud services, or does not appear in MDATP portal as expected, see [Verify client connectivity to Microsoft Defender ATP service URLs](configure-proxy-internet.md#verify-client-connectivity-to-microsoft-defender-atp-service-urls).
